Commencement of Foreign Exchange Management Act set by notification, appointing 1st June 2000 as the enforcement date. The Central Government, exercising the power conferred by sub section (4) of section 1, by G.S.R. 371(E) dated 1 May 2000, appoints the 1st day of June, 2000 as the date on which the Foreign Exchange Management Act, 1999 shall come into force, thereby activating the Act's regulatory framework for foreign exchange.
